How much do power bi developer fulltime j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 3, 2026, the average hourly pay for power bi developer fulltime in Dallas, TX is $53.21,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$43.51 and $60.87 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Power Bi Developer Fulltime vs Power Bi Analyst?

AspectPower Bi Developer FulltimePower Bi Analyst
Required CredentialsTypically requires a degree in IT, Computer Science, or related field; certifications like Microsoft Certified Data Analyst Associate are commonSimilar credentials; often holds certifications like Microsoft Certified Data Analyst Associate
Work EnvironmentFull-time employment in corporate, consulting, or tech companies; involved in development and deployment of BI solutionsFull-time or contract roles in various industries; focuses on data analysis, reporting, and insights
Employer & Industry UsageUsed across industries for building dashboards, data modeling, and report developmentUsed for interpreting data, creating reports, and providing insights to support decision-making

While both roles require similar skills and certifications, Power Bi Developers Fulltime focus more on building and deploying BI solutions, whereas Power Bi Analysts primarily interpret data and generate reports. The roles often overlap but differ in scope and responsibilities within organizations.

What you will be doing:

  • Data analysts will share requirements and documentation so the BI Developercan provide feedback, suggesting alternative designs/solutions when appropriate.

  • You will be building data lakes, optimizing ETL pipelines, plus managing databases with SQL, all to provide actionable customer insights.

  • Your work will be delivered on client specified timeframes (e.g., weekly, monthly, quarterly) but can also be quick turnaround support, especially when creating ad hoc tools.

  • Your daily tasks will be highly varied and could include helping maintain data integrity across a wide variety of energy efficiency programs, troubleshooting data quality issues and communicating their impacts, supporting ongoing custom report maintenance, etc.

What we need you to have (minimum qualifications):

  • Bachelor's degreein computer science, IT, Data, Science, Math or related fields. *Applicants can substitute one year of related experience for one year of education.

  • 2+ years with Fabric, Azure Databricks, or an equivalent ETL tool.

  • 2+ years of experience working with SQL Server (e.g., query tuning, writing procedures/functions, building views).

  • 2+ years of experience in SQL querying and scripting, with experience optimizing complex queries for performance and scalability.

  • 2+ years of experience working with BI tools (e.g., Power BI/Tableau).

  • Must be able to pass a Motor Vehicle Record (MVR) check and Background Checks including Drug Screenings.

What we would like you to have:

  • Experience in rapidly maintaining, supporting, and producing regular reporting deliverables for a variety of audiences.SSRS highly preferred.

  • Exposure to the utility, energy, and/or energy efficiency sectors.

  • Strong understanding of database structures, normalization, and data modeling, including how to streamline and automate repetitive tasks.

  • Experience modernizing from legacy BI systems into cloud-based applications/platforms, including creating technical documentation and architectural diagrams.

  • Experience using Fabric, Azure, Python, PySpark, Hadoop.
